The role picks, weapon configs, and ability combos that win rounds on Live Fire in Halo Infinite. Site-by-site breakdowns + the loadouts that actually pair with them.
Aggress: Coordinated rotation on Top Mid: Power Weapon grenade-arcs the contested spot, Slayer pushes on the explosion, Objective Runner secures, Support cleans up. OS pickup is the round-opener — Power Weapon traps the rotation in.
Anchor: Stack Top Mid: 3-on-zone with Slayer + Support + Objective Runner, Power Weapon plays off-angle for the round-opener pick. Hold the timing of power-up respawns. OS denial with Sniper from Tower wins the early game.
Aggress: Spawn-flip aggression on Bottom Mid: push hard to force a spawn flip behind the enemy team. Slayer entries, Power Weapon traps the rotation, Objective Runner controls the new spawn area. Loading Dock + Garage flank isolates back-line on the take.
Anchor: Defensive setup on Bottom Mid: Power Weapon controls the high ground, Slayer trades from cover, Objective Runner holds the spawn area, Support cycles utility on push. Loading Dock anchor with grenades denies standard Bottom Mid push.
Aggress: Coordinated rotation on Red Base: Power Weapon grenade-arcs the contested spot, Slayer pushes on the explosion, Objective Runner secures, Support cleans up. Red Catwalk vertical pressure denies the standard hold.
Anchor: Stack Red Base: 3-on-zone with Slayer + Support + Objective Runner, Power Weapon plays off-angle for the round-opener pick. Hold the timing of power-up respawns. Red Catwalk + Red Hall cross-fire wins the base hold.
Aggress: Spawn-flip aggression on Blue Base: push hard to force a spawn flip behind the enemy team. Slayer entries, Power Weapon traps the rotation, Objective Runner controls the new spawn area. Blue Catwalk vertical pressure denies the standard hold.
Anchor: Defensive setup on Blue Base: Power Weapon controls the high ground, Slayer trades from cover, Objective Runner holds the spawn area, Support cycles utility on push. Blue Catwalk + Blue Hall cross-fire wins the base hold.
